The UBeesize Large Grill Mat is a heavy-duty, fireproof protective pad that shields your deck, patio, or grass from grease, sparks, and heat damage during outdoor cooking. Ideal for backyard grillers, campers, and tailgaters who want easy cleanup and peace of mind while grilling near their home or campsite.

The UBeesize Large 65x48 Inch Under Grill Mat is exactly what you need if you love outdoor cooking but worry about grease stains, embers, or heat ruining your deck, patio, or lawn. This isn't a grill or smoker – it's a protective pad that sits under your cooking gear, catching all the drips and sparks so your outdoor space stays clean and safe. Whether you're firing up a charcoal kettle, a propane gas grill, or even a fire pit for s'mores, this mat gives you peace of mind without sacrificing flavor or convenience.

Backyard grillers who host weekend BBQs will appreciate how the double-sided silicone coating handles hot grease and stray embers. It withstands temperatures up to 2000°F, so flare-ups from burgers or steaks won't scorch your wooden deck. Campers and tailgaters will love the portability: the mat folds down small and comes with a storage bag, making it easy to toss in the car for a weekend at the campsite or a parking lot cookout before the big game. RV owners can use it to protect their site from dripping oil or hot coals, keeping the campground neat and avoiding cleanup hassles.

Performance-wise, this mat does its job without fuss. It's not about heat consistency or smoke flavor – those are for the grill itself. But what it does, it does well: the surface is oil-proof and waterproof, so grease doesn't soak through. After a long cook, you can just spray it with a garden hose or wipe with a soapy cloth. No scrubbing needed. The edges are finely stitched for durability, and the mat won't curl up or crack under sun or heat. It lies flat and stays put, especially once your grill or fire pit is on top.

Build quality is solid for the price. The fiberglass core feels sturdy, and the silicone coating adds a non-stick quality that makes cleaning almost effortless. It's not the thickest mat on the market, but for most residential backyards, it provides plenty of protection. If you're cooking on rough or uneven ground, you might want to place it on a flat surface to avoid tripping hazards. Also, because it's lightweight, a strong wind could lift an empty mat – but once your equipment is on it, that's not an issue.

Limitations are minor. This is strictly a protective pad, not a cooking surface. You can't grill directly on it. Some heavy-duty grillers might prefer a larger size if they have a huge offset smoker or multiple cookers, but the 65x48 inches covers most backyard setups. Another thing: if your grill is on a highly polished deck, the mat might slide a little unless you have something heavy on it. That's easy to fix by placing a few stones or the grill itself on the corners.

Overall, the UBeesize Grill Mat is a practical, affordable addition to any outdoor cooking setup. If you grill on a wood deck, a patio, or even a grassy lawn, this mat will save you from scrubbing stains and worrying about fire safety. It's especially handy for campers and tailgaters who want to leave the site clean. For the price and performance, it's a smart buy for any outdoor cooking enthusiast.

The Keter Unity XL is an outdoor prep station and storage cabinet featuring a stainless-steel work surface and 78 gallons of weather-resistant storage. It gives backyard cooks a dedicated space for meat prep, barbecue tools, and fuel supplies right next to the smoker.

The Keter Unity XL Outdoor Entertainment Cart is an all-weather prep station and patio storage cabinet tailored for backyard cooks who need functional counter space next to their smoker or grill. Anyone running extended low-and-slow cooks knows that balancing cutting boards, meat probes, spritz bottles, and heavy cuts on a small smoker side shelf quickly becomes a hassle. This unit serves as a dedicated outdoor workstation and accessory locker for backyard cooks, pellet smoker owners, offset firebox tenders, and patio entertainers.

In everyday barbecue prep, having a wide, stable surface makes a noticeable difference. The cart features an integrated stainless-steel top that provides ample room for resting smoked meats, wrapping briskets or pork butts in butcher paper, and applying dry rubs to ribs before they go onto the grates. Because the top is stainless steel, it handles food staging, platters, and general prep tasks effectively, though using a cutting board is recommended to avoid scratching the metal finish during heavy slicing.

Build quality relies on heavy-duty, all-weather resin paired with Keter's DecoCoat finish, which provides the appearance of natural Ashwood without the upkeep of real lumber. Unlike traditional wood carts that require regular staining or painted metal tables that can corrode in humid environments, the resin body is designed to resist rust, peeling, warping, and denting. Underneath the steel counter sits a 78-gallon enclosed storage cabinet, providing protected space to store wood pellets, charcoal bags, cast-iron cookware, and clean butcher paper.

Setup involves standard panel assembly, and once assembled, the cart measures 20.5 inches deep, 52.7 inches wide, and 35.5 inches tall. Everyday usability is enhanced by practical outdoor cooking conveniences, including side hooks for long-handled tongs, an integrated towel bar for wiping down grease, and a built-in spice holder to keep seasonings close at hand. Routine cleaning is straightforward: the resin frame wipes down with mild soap and water, while the stainless counter cleans up quickly after sauce drips or grease splatters.

While the cart is sturdy and spacious, it does have a few practical considerations. The 52.7-inch overall length demands a fair amount of patio real estate, so cooks working on compact apartment balconies may find the footprint slightly large. Additionally, although the resin structure is weather-resistant, keeping the polished appearance of the stainless-steel top free from water spots and outdoor pollen will require periodic wipe-downs or a protective outdoor cover.

For outdoor cooks looking to expand their patio smoking setup with dedicated prep space and weather-resistant storage, the Keter Unity XL offers strong utility. It effectively helps organize backyard smokers by keeping fuels, accessories, and seasonings in one durable, attractive station.

Storage & BBQ Functionality

The 78-gallon enclosed storage compartment is one of the standout features for barbecue cooks. Having weather-resistant dry storage directly on the patio means you can keep bags of wood pellets, charcoal lumps, wood chunks, and extra drip pans right where you cook instead of hauling them back and forth from a garage or shed.

The built-in exterior accessories are tailored to outdoor cooking ergonomics. The side utensil hooks hold meat forks, griddle spatulas, and heavy-duty tongs within reach, while the integrated spice caddy secures barbecue rubs, spray bottles, and sauces so your primary prep surface remains open for food handling.

Cleaning & Maintenance

Maintaining this prep station requires minimal effort compared to traditional painted steel or unfinished wood outdoor furniture. The resin body resists outdoor elements and requires only an occasional rinse with a garden hose or a wipe-down with mild dish soap to remove grease splatters and outdoor dust.

The stainless-steel worktop can be maintained with standard food-safe kitchen cleaners or stainless-steel polish to remove oil residue after preparing barbecue cuts. Using cutting boards rather than slicing directly on the metal top will help prevent surface scratches and maintain its smooth finish over multiple cooking seasons.

This 112-inch propane outdoor kitchen island combines a 108,000 BTU cooking setup, pizza oven, rotisserie, and refrigerator for versatile backyard entertaining. It is an excellent match for home cooks wanting an all-in-one 304 stainless steel patio cooking center.

The Vaztrlus 112-Inch Stainless Steel Outdoor Kitchen Island is a comprehensive backyard cooking center designed for serious home entertainers and outdoor cooks who want a complete culinary station on their patio. Featuring a high-output propane grill, a dedicated 35,000 BTU pizza oven, a rear ceramic infrared burner with a rotisserie kit, and an integrated outdoor refrigerator, this multi-unit setup replaces separate cooking appliances with an all-in-one footprint. It is specifically aimed at homeowners looking to host large family gatherings, game-day cookouts, and weekend parties without repeatedly carrying food back and forth to the indoor kitchen.

In terms of cooking capability, the island delivers a substantial 108,000 total BTUs of heat across its specialized cooking sections. The primary gas grill utilizes stainless steel burners generating 72,000 BTUs, complemented by a rear ceramic infrared burner tailored for rotisserie poultry, roasts, and high-heat searing. Beside the primary grill, the standalone 35,000 BTU pizza oven adds stone-baking functionality, while the grill configuration supports smoker grill techniques for low-and-slow barbecue tasks. Multiple dedicated control dials allow users to manage distinct thermal zones simultaneously, making it possible to sear steaks, slow-roast a whole chicken, and bake pizzas across one continuous countertop run.

Construction revolves around 304 marine-grade stainless steel, which forms the primary cabinetry, burner bodies, and cooking enclosures. The preparation surfaces are topped with polished granite, providing an expansive, sanitary food prep area suitable for trimming briskets, seasoning pork shoulders, and plating grilled vegetables. Storage is integrated directly into the base cart with stainless steel utility drawers and enclosed cabinets, allowing grill accessories, rotisserie components, and wood chip trays to stay organized. A built-in wine cooler and beverage refrigerator fits neatly underneath the counter, keeping chilled drinks and marinades accessible outdoors.

Setting up a complete outdoor kitchen often involves extensive masonry and plumbing, but this modular unit arrives almost fully assembled to streamline backyard installation. Because the assembled system measures 112 inches across and weighs 554 pounds, patio placement demands a completely flat, non-combustible foundation with ample clearance. Everyday maintenance requires routine wiping down of both the granite and stainless steel panels. The manufacturer explicitly advises regular cleaning and protection from heavy downpours or prolonged direct sunlight, as environmental exposure can lead to surface spotting on untreated stainless steel.

Prospective buyers should evaluate a few realistic limitations before committing to a system of this scale. The sheer 112-inch footprint requires a dedicated, spacious patio layout, making it unsuitable for modest decks or compact yards. Operating several high-output cooking zones simultaneously will naturally cycle through propane fuel quickly, requiring diligent tank management or spare tanks during extensive entertaining sessions. Additionally, the manufacturer notes that minor cosmetic scratches can occur during freight delivery due to the sheet metal construction, so buyers should expect minor surface imperfections upon unboxing.

For backyard cooks who frequently host large crowds and want an integrated outdoor kitchen without commissioning a custom contractor build, the Vaztrlus 112-Inch Island offers notable convenience and versatility. Its combination of high-BTU propane grilling, specialized rotisserie roasting, independent pizza baking, and refrigerated storage brings commercial-style functionality to residential patios. As long as you have the required deck space and follow steady maintenance routines to safeguard the exterior metal, this multi-cooker setup serves as an impressive centerpiece for outdoor barbecue entertaining.

Cooking Versatility

This outdoor island offers an expansive multi-cooker setup that eliminates the need for separate backyard cooking devices. The primary grill chamber manages high-heat searing and indirect cooking across its primary stainless steel burners, while the rear ceramic infrared burner pairs directly with the included rotisserie kit for slow-spinning chickens, prime rib, or pork loins.

The integrated 35,000 BTU standalone pizza oven operates independently from the main grill chamber, reaching the high temperatures required for bubbling artisan crusts, flatbreads, and baked sides. The grill layout also accommodates smoker grill techniques, allowing users to introduce wood smoke flavor profiles while utilizing indirect gas heat for classic low-and-slow barbecue cuts.

Care & Maintenance

While 304 marine-grade stainless steel offers substantial resistance against rust and outdoor exposure, the manufacturer explicitly notes that it is not completely maintenance-free. Regular wipe-downs with a stainless steel cleaner and microfiber cloth are essential to remove grease splatter, atmospheric salt, and moisture deposits that can cause surface discoloration over time.

To protect your investment and maintain the polish of the granite countertops, positioning the island under an outdoor shelter or using a heavy-duty grill cover between cookouts is strongly advised. Regular grease tray cleanouts and wiping down the interior refrigerator seals will ensure the complete cooking center stays hygienic and operational throughout grilling season.

Buying Guide: Key Factors for Your Grilling Station

Selecting the ideal outdoor station configuration requires balancing cooking ergonomics with available deck space. A dependable layout streamlines food preparation, keeps heat sources safe, and protects surrounding structures from grease and weather exposure. Evaluating your layout needs helps determine whether a sprawling island or a compact prep cart best suits your deck.

Available patio space dictates whether a permanent built-in island or a wheeled cart makes practical sense for your backyard. Larger modular islands provide expansive granite surfaces and enclosed cabinetry, but they require dedicated space and stable ground. Compact carts with locking caster wheels let you reposition prep surfaces away from strong winds or store them during off-season months. Enclosed cabinets also shelter extra fuel, wood pellets, or outdoor cookware from damp conditions between cookouts.

Routine maintenance becomes significantly simpler when your station features non-porous surfaces and proper surface protection. Heavy-duty under-grill mats shield wood decks and stone pavers from stubborn grease stains, stray embers, and hot sauce splatters. Stainless steel countertops wipe down easily with mild soap, resisting heat damage from hot pans or grill platters. Investing in smooth drainage sinks or integrated grease collection trays prevents buildup that could attract pests or cause sanitation issues.

Functional prep space keeps seasonings, cutting boards, and tongs within arm reach so cooking remains effortless. Integrated details like paper towel holders, spice caddies, bottle openers, and trash compartments eliminate constant trips back into the kitchen. Many cooks who frequently prepare tender steak dinner recipes appreciate wide stainless prep surfaces for resting meat and carving family-sized roasts. Having dedicated storage hooks and organized prep tiers ensures every tool has its place during high-heat cooking sessions.

Investing in the right station setup ultimately transforms routine outdoor cooking into a seamless entertaining experience. Prioritizing durable construction and practical storage ensures your grilling area remains enjoyable and clutter-free for years to come.
